Artificial intelligence (AI), a term that echoes throughout technology, encapsulates the development of computer systems capable of performing tasks that typically require human thought. At its core, AI leverages complex algorithms and vast datasets to analyze information, recognizing patterns and producing predictions.
There are various types of AI, each with unique capabilities. Supervised learning, for instance, entails training algorithms on labeled data to categorize future outcomes. Unsupervised learning, on the other hand, allows algorithms to reveal hidden structures and relationships within unlabeled data.

Can We Trust AI Detection Tools? The Accuracy Debate
The rise of generative AI has sparked a race to develop tools capable of distinguishing human-written text from content produced by algorithms. But are these AI detectors truly reliable? Researchers argue that while progress has been made, there are substantial challenges to achieving foolproof detection. One key issue is the rapid evolution of AI models, which constantly learn and adapt, making it a moving target for detectors. Furthermore, the subtle nature of language frequently makes it difficult for algorithms to detect telltale signs of AI-generated text.
In conclusion, the accuracy of AI detectors remains a complex issue. While there are promising developments, it's essential to more info approach these tools with caution. Continued research and development are necessary to improve their performance and ensure that they can effectively combat the potential risks associated with AI-generated content.

Can AI Really Think? Exploring the Nature of Consciousness
The question of whether artificial intelligence can truly think like humans is a complex one that has engaged the curiosity of philosophers and scientists alike. While AI systems have made remarkable strides in areas such as information recognition and problem deduction, there is still much debate surrounding the nature of consciousness itself.
Some argue that consciousness is an essential property of living beings, while others believe it emerges from the interaction of sufficiently complex systems. Measuring consciousness in AI presents a considerable challenge, as we lack a clear and precise understanding of how it arises in humans.
- One viewpoint is that consciousness is based in our experiential engagements with the world.
- Another, some propose that consciousness is a product of self-awareness.
In spite of these obstacles, the ongoing investigation into AI and consciousness provides valuable understandings into the nature of our own minds.
